Miltos Ladikas is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Global and Planetary Change and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Miltos Ladikas has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 192 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 5 papers in Global and Planetary Change and 3 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Miltos Ladikas’s work include Sustainability and Climate Change Governance (5 papers), Innovation, Technology, and Society (3 papers) and Biotechnology and Related Fields (3 papers). Miltos Ladikas is often cited by papers focused on Sustainability and Climate Change Governance (5 papers), Innovation, Technology, and Society (3 papers) and Biotechnology and Related Fields (3 papers). Miltos Ladikas coll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Austria and United Kingdom. Miltos Ladikas's co-authors include Michael Decker, Doris Schroeder, Yandong Zhao, Dirk Stemerding, Sachin Chaturvedi, Theodoros Karapiperis, Gianluca Quaglio, Jens Schippl, Leonhard Hennen and Huanming Yang and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Biotechnology, Sustainability and European Journal of Public Health.
